not marked as a favorite taxon Xyris brevifolia Michaux. Common name: Shortleaf Yellow-eyed-grass. Phenology: Jun-Aug. Habitat: Wet sands of pinelands, especially seasonally wet, open, white sands of spodosol longleaf pine flatwoods (Leon series soils), margins of Carolina bay sandrims. Distribution: Se. NC south to s. FL, west to s. AL and w. FL; West Indies and South America.
